Why are learner satisfaction surveys not ROI?
Post-training satisfaction surveys measure whether learners enjoyed the session, not whether their behavior changed. Alliger et al. (1997) show the correlation between reaction-level scores and downstream job performance is near zero. Reporting happy-sheet averages as ROI is a category error — it measures the wrong construct.
Every L&D leader knows this. The reason satisfaction surveys persist is that measuring behavior change used to be expensive — until simulation brought the marginal cost down by an order of magnitude.
What is Kirkpatrick Level 3 and why does it matter now?
Kirkpatrick Level 3 measures behavior change on the job — the level the Kirkpatrick model has always identified as most impactful and hardest to measure (Kirkpatrick & Kirkpatrick, 2006). Simulation-based assessment turns Level 3 into a repeatable, scalable measurement using the same calibrated rubric before and after the program.
Most L&D functions report Level 1 (reaction) and Level 2 (learning) because those were the only levels affordably measurable. Level 3 at scale reframes the entire budget conversation from anecdote to evidence.
What effect size counts as a meaningful L&D outcome?
Cohen's d is the standard metric for pre/post capability change: d≈0.2 is small, d≈0.5 is moderate, d≈0.8 is large (Cohen, 1988). Reporting L&D outcomes in effect sizes rather than completion rates lets the CFO compare the return on training against any other capital allocation using a common statistical language.
It also — for the first time — lets L&D defend its budget in a downturn with something other than testimonials.
How do you set up the pre/post measurement loop?
Run a four-step loop: baseline the target capabilities with calibrated simulations before the program, deliver the intervention, re-measure with the same (or parallel-form) scenarios, and report pre/post Cohen's d per competency with confidence intervals at cohort and individual level. The loop is auditable and reproducible.
- Baseline: measure target capabilities with calibrated simulations before the program starts.
- Intervention: run the L&D program.
- Re-measure: run the same scenarios (or parallel-form scenarios calibrated to the same difficulty).
- Report: pre/post effect size per competency, with confidence intervals, at the cohort and individual level.
